What are the main types of preschool options available in Dubach, LA?
In Dubach, your primary options are typically faith-based preschools, home-based daycare programs that include preschool curriculum, and potentially the pre-K program at Dubach Elementary School, which is part of the Lincoln Parish School District. Due to the town's size, there are fewer large, standalone preschool centers compared to larger cities, so exploring licensed family childcare homes is a common route for local parents.
How much does preschool typically cost in Dubach?
Preschool costs in Dubach are generally more affordable than in metropolitan areas, but vary by program type. Licensed home-based programs may range from $100-$150 per week, while church-affiliated preschools often have lower weekly or monthly rates. It's crucial to ask what the fee includes, such as meals and supplies, and to inquire about the Louisiana Child Care Assistance Program (CCAP) if you qualify for subsidized care.
What should I look for to ensure a preschool is high-quality and licensed in Louisiana?
First, verify the program is licensed by the Louisiana Department of Education. You can check this online via the Louisiana Child Care Search portal. Look for signs of quality like a structured daily routine, qualified teachers, a safe and clean environment, and age-appropriate learning materials. In a small community like Dubach, speaking directly with other parents about their experiences is also an invaluable resource.
Are there any free public pre-K options for 4-year-olds in Dubach?
Yes, the Lincoln Parish School District offers a free LA 4 early childhood program for eligible 4-year-olds at Dubach Elementary School. Enrollment is based on family income and other risk factors. You should contact the school directly or the Lincoln Parish School Board office to check your child's eligibility, as spaces can be limited and often fill quickly.
How can I find and tour preschools in a small town like Dubach?
Start by asking for recommendations from local parents, your pediatrician, or community centers like the Lincoln Parish Library. Contact programs directly to schedule a visit; in a small town, directors are often very accommodating. When touring, observe how staff interact with children, check the safety of the play areas, and ask about their curriculum's approach to preparing children for kindergarten at Dubach Elementary.
